Abstract

The paper the study of new light-cured composite dental materials by atomic absorption spectroscopy are considered. High-quality aesthetics, durability, functionality and maximum preservation of hard dental tissues are the result of new adhesive preparation and improvement of the physico-chemical and optical properties of composites, therefore, the study of the optical properties of composites is relevant and promising. The article the objects under study, the appearance of the spectrophotometer, the optical scheme and the technical characteristics of the device are presented. In the study of restorative dental composites, different absorption capacity of materials was obtained. Maximum absorption in all composite materials in the wavelength range = 250…360 nm was detected.
